8420.01 - PANDEMICS AND OTHER MEDICAL EMERGENCIES
A pandemic is an outbreak of an infectious disease. The Superintendent shall establish a Pandemic Response Team ("PRT") to develop a Pandemic Plan in coordination with local government and law enforcement officials.
The Pandemic Plan should include:
A. | a communication method for school schedule changes, busing changes, and school closure; | ||
B. | an educational pandemic prevention program for staff and students; | ||
C. | provision for the business office to maintain continuity of operations during a pandemic; | ||
D. | provision for distance-based learning for students (i.e., Internet instruction, community channel broadcast) to maintain continuity of education; | ||
E. | policies and procedures for staff and student absences and extended leaves of absence due to a pandemic; | ||
F. | policies and procedures for isolation and possible transportation of students and staff who become ill at school due to a pandemic; | ||
G. | a plan of communication regarding pandemic status to students, parents, and staff; | ||
H. | a plan for operating the District with less staff due to a pandemic; | ||
I. | a designee responsible for establishing timelines within the Pandemic Plan and ensuring that such timelines are met and implementation of the plan occurs; and | ||
J. | other emergency procedures necessary for the District to deal with a pandemic. |
The Pandemic Plan should be reviewed annually by the PRT and updated as appropriate.
